Why These Are the Top Subaru Repair Auto Repair Shops in Slingerlands

** The Subaru repair market in the Slingerlands area is robust, reflecting the brand's significant popularity in the Northeast. The quality of service is generally high, with a clear bifurcation between dealership and independent specialist providers. * **Competition Level:** High. Residents have immediate access to the major dealership (DeNooyer) and a competitive landscape of well-regarded independent shops within a 15-minute drive in Albany and Latham. This competition benefits consumers through competitive pricing and a focus on customer service. * **Average Quality:** The average quality for Subaru-specific work is above the national average due to the high density of Subarus, which forces shops to develop specialized expertise to remain competitive.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ows a standard tiered structure. Authorized dealerships (Provider 1) command the highest labor rates but offer the manufacturer's warranty on repairs. Top-tier independents (Providers 2 & 3) typically offer labor rates 20-30% lower than the dealership while often using high-quality aftermarket or OEM parts. For core Subaru-specific issues like head gaskets or turbo repairs, the independents often represent the best value, while complex electronic or safety system repairs (EyeSight) are best handled by the dealership.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about subaru repair services in Slingerlands, NY

What are the most common Subaru repair issues for cars driven in the Slingerlands area?

Given our local climate with snowy winters and salted roads, common issues include premature brake and suspension component corrosion, as well as head gasket concerns on older models (typically pre-2012). Subaru's all-wheel-drive system is robust but requires regular differential and transmission fluid services, especially for those who drive on rural or hilly roads around Albany County.

How do I find a quality, trustworthy Subaru repair shop in Slingerlands?

Look for shops that are Subaru-specific specialists or have Subaru-specific training and diagnostic tools, as the brand's boxer engines and symmetrical AWD require specialized knowledge. In Slingerlands and the greater Capital Region, seek out shops with strong local reputations, verified online reviews, and certifications like ASE, and consider if they use genuine or high-quality aftermarket parts.

When should I seek local service instead of going to the dealership?

For major repairs like engine or transmission work, or for complex electrical diagnostics, seeking a local Subaru specialist can offer significant cost savings and often more personalized service than the dealership. For warranty-covered repairs or specific recall work, you may need to visit the dealership, but for routine maintenance and most common repairs, a trusted local shop in the Slingerlands area is an excellent choice.

Are Subaru repairs more expensive in the Capital Region compared to other areas?

Labor rates in the Capital Region, including Slingerlands, are generally competitive but can be slightly lower than in major metropolitan areas like NYC. The primary cost factors are the complexity of Subaru's engineering and the price of parts; using a local independent specialist instead of a dealership is the most effective way to manage repair costs without sacrificing quality.

What local driving conditions should I discuss with my Subaru repair technician?

Definitely discuss frequent short-trip commuting, which is common in the suburbs, as it can lead to battery strain and moisture buildup in the exhaust. Also, inform them if you frequently drive on the hilly or unpaved roads common in the Helderbergs or the Catskills, as this can accelerate wear on suspension, brakes, and the AWD system, necessitating more frequent inspections.
